Gotham City Hall

After Harvey Dent underwent cosmetic surgery to remove Two-Face, Commissioner Gordon informed him he would be allowed to return to City Hall but as assistant to the Assistant District Attorney. Dent let it sink in and accepted the decision. He vowed to do everything in his power to earn Gotham's trust again. Soon after, Batman and Robin had another encounter with Two-Face. They went to Gotham City Hall and confronted Dent in his office. Robin pointed out his face was normal. Dent asked to what he owed the unexpected visit. Batman apologized for the abrupt visit and informed him Two-Face was the mastermind behind King Tut's and Bookworm's latest crime sprees. Robin asked Dent where he was within the last two hours. Dent claimed he was in his office all night. Batman asked Dent to excuse Robin's over-zealousness and stated they could not rule anyone out currently. Dent understood and pledged his full cooperation. He wondered what kind of a twisted monster would threaten the reputation he worked so hard to rebuild.

Batman promised they would not rest until they got to the bottom of the mystery. Dent could not wait to put the imposter behind bars. In the meantime, he needed to finalize the plans for his charity bachelor auction. He asked if their mutual friend Bruce Wayne told him about it. Batman stated his friendship with Mr. Wayne didn't extend to charity functions and bid Dent good night. Batman and Robin made their way down the side of building. Robin wasn't convinced and knew Dent had to be involved with Two-Face somehow. Batman cited Dent had always been a loyal friend and he still had faith in him. Dent pulled his blinds, picked up the phone and dialed. He could not go on and insisted that Two-Face stop the madness at once. Two-Face reminded them of their deal, he framed the super crooks and used their stolen loot to finance his criminal coup while Dent convicted them and reclaimed his sterling reputation as District Attorney of Gotham City. Dent pointed out Batman would eventually discover their secret.

Two-Face was confident it would be too late and he would find out his. Dent hung up and sighed. Robin went alone on an unsanctioned stake out outside City Hall. Once Dent left City Hall, Robin followed him around the city right to the newly rebuilt Evil Extractor and was knocked out.
